

Step into History at the Benbow Hotel
🏨 Tucked away in Northern California’s redwood country, the Benbow Historic Inn feels like stepping into a bygone era of roaring fireplaces, wood-paneled lounges, and riverside charm. Built in 1926 and steeped in history, this Tudor-style retreat invites travelers to slow down and savor the grace of a different time. Whether you're sipping tea on the terrace, curling up with a book, or venturing out to nearby redwood groves, Benbow blends comfort with character in the most timeless way.

📚 Bring a Good Book or Journal – Benbow’s atmosphere invites slow, reflective moments. The cozy nooks, terraces, and riverside spots are perfect for reading, writing, or simply soaking in the scenery without distractions.
🌲 Pack Layers, Even in Summer – Mornings and evenings can be cool near the river and in the redwoods, even if it’s hot during the day. A lightweight jacket or wrap keeps you comfortable.
🎻 Ask About Live Music Nights – Sometimes the Inn hosts small concerts or special events. Check their calendar or call ahead—you might enjoy a surprise evening of live piano or jazz.
🚶♀️ Wander Off the Main Trails – When visiting nearby parks, venture onto lesser-known side trails. You’ll often find secluded groves and hidden picnic spots far from the tourist crowds.
🍷 Plan a Slow Dinner – Dining at the Inn is an experience in itself. Book a table for sunset, order local wines, and let the evening unfold at a relaxed, old-world pace.
🚗 Use the Inn as a Base for Mini-Road Trips – Benbow is perfectly located for short scenic drives to the Lost Coast, Shelter Cove, or through Avenue of the Giants without rushing.
📸 Wake Early for Golden Light – The early morning mist over the Eel River and redwoods creates some of the most magical, photogenic moments—worth setting an early alarm!
🚨 Pro Tip: Bring a small pair of binoculars—you’ll catch views of bald eagles, herons, or deer wandering near the riverbank right from the Inn’s terrace! 🦅✨
when to visit
🌷 Spring (March–May) – The surrounding redwoods and hills burst into green, wildflowers bloom, and the weather is mild—perfect for scenic drives and peaceful hikes.
☀️ Early Fall (September–October) – Warm days, crisp evenings, and fewer crowds make this a beautiful, relaxed time to explore the redwoods and enjoy cozy evenings at the inn.
⛱️ Summer (June–August) – Great for family trips and river activities, though it’s the busiest season and reservations at the Inn and parks book up fast.
🔥 Winter (December–February) – A magical time for quiet getaways: misty mornings, roaring fireplaces, lower rates, and a cozier, slower vibe surrounded by misty redwood forests.
🚨 Pro Tip: If you want both outdoor adventure and peaceful quiet at the Inn, midweek in late spring or early fall is absolutely ideal! 🌿✨
